The perimeter of a rectangular field is 82 m and its area is 400 m2. Find the breadth of the rectangle.

उत्तर
Let the breadth of the rectangle be x meters. Then
Perimeter = 82 meters
2(length + breadth) = 82
(length + x) = 41
length = 41 − x
And area of the rectangle
length x bradth = 400
(41 − x) x = 400
41x − x2 = 400
x2 − 41x + 400 = 0
x2 − 25x − 16x + 400 = 0
x(x − 25) −16(x − 25) = 0
(x − 25) (x − 16) = 0
or
x − 16 = 0
x = 16
Since perimeter is 82 meter. So breadth can’t be 25 meter.
Hence, breadth 16 meters.
